19 package org.apache.commons.jcs.jcache;
20
21 import javax.cache.configuration.CacheEntryListenerConfiguration;
22 import javax.cache.configuration.Factory;
23 import javax.cache.event.CacheEntryCreatedListener;
24 import javax.cache.event.CacheEntryEvent;
25 import javax.cache.event.CacheEntryEventFilter;
26 import javax.cache.event.CacheEntryExpiredListener;
27 import javax.cache.event.CacheEntryListener;
28 import javax.cache.event.CacheEntryListenerException;
29 import javax.cache.event.CacheEntryRemovedListener;
30 import javax.cache.event.CacheEntryUpdatedListener;
31 import java.io.Closeable;
32 import java.util.ArrayList;
33 import java.util.List;
34
35 public class JCSListener<K, V> implements Closeable
36 {
37 private final boolean oldValue;
38 private final boolean synchronous;
39 private final CacheEntryEventFilter<? super K, ? super V> filter;
40 private final CacheEntryListener<? super K, ? super V> delegate;
41 private final boolean remove;
42 private final boolean expire;
43 private final boolean update;
44 private final boolean create;
45
46 public JCSListener(final CacheEntryListenerConfiguration<K, V> cacheEntryListenerConfiguration)
47 {
48 oldValue = cacheEntryListenerConfiguration.isOldValueRequired();
49 synchronous = cacheEntryListenerConfiguration.isSynchronous();
50
51 final Factory<CacheEntryEventFilter<? super K, ? super V>> filterFactory = cacheEntryListenerConfiguration
52 .getCacheEntryEventFilterFactory();
53 if (filterFactory == null)
54 {
55 filter = NoFilter.INSTANCE;
56 }
57 else
58 {
59 filter = filterFactory.create();
60 }
61
62 delegate = cacheEntryListenerConfiguration.getCacheEntryListenerFactory().create();
63 remove = CacheEntryRemovedListener.class.isInstance(delegate);
64 expire = CacheEntryExpiredListener.class.isInstance(delegate);
65 update = CacheEntryUpdatedListener.class.isInstance(delegate);
66 create = CacheEntryCreatedListener.class.isInstance(delegate);
67 }
68
69 public void onRemoved(final List<CacheEntryEvent<? extends K, ? extends V>> events) throws CacheEntryListenerException
70 {
71 if (remove)
72 {
73 CacheEntryRemovedListener.class.cast(delegate).onRemoved(filter(events));
74 }
75 }
76
77 public void onExpired(final List<CacheEntryEvent<? extends K, ? extends V>> events) throws CacheEntryListenerException
78 {
79 if (expire)
80 {
81 CacheEntryExpiredListener.class.cast(delegate).onExpired(filter(events));
82 }
83 }
84
85 public void onUpdated(final List<CacheEntryEvent<? extends K, ? extends V>> events) throws CacheEntryListenerException
86 {
87 if (update)
88 {
89 CacheEntryUpdatedListener.class.cast(delegate).onUpdated(filter(events));
90 }
91 }
92
93 public void onCreated(final List<CacheEntryEvent<? extends K, ? extends V>> events) throws CacheEntryListenerException
94 {
95 if (create)
96 {
97 CacheEntryCreatedListener.class.cast(delegate).onCreated(filter(events));
98 }
99 }
100
101 private Iterable<CacheEntryEvent<? extends K, ? extends V>> filter(final List<CacheEntryEvent<? extends K, ? extends V>> events)
102 {
103 if (filter == NoFilter.INSTANCE)
104 {
105 return events;
106 }
107
108 final List<CacheEntryEvent<? extends K, ? extends V>> filtered = new ArrayList<CacheEntryEvent<? extends K, ? extends V>>(
109 events.size());
110 for (final CacheEntryEvent<? extends K, ? extends V> event : events)
111 {
112 if (filter.evaluate(event))
113 {
114 filtered.add(event);
115 }
116 }
117 return filtered;
118 }
119
120 @Override
121 public void close()
122 {
123 if (Closeable.class.isInstance(delegate)) {
124 Closeable.class.cast(delegate);
125 }
126 }
127 }
